Output 223b607d295f469d9f288ae09a871d56d066732f12bb531eb969704e715b621f:172

value
39500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81d468995451a58037a861d88d4b8b8a4d46017d OP_EQUAL
address
3DXVYhQN6FEaunTzZsmv7pX5hckpJa6z1k
transaction
223b607d295f469d9f288ae09a871d56d066732f12bb531eb969704e715b621f